Let the user Deselect from Selection

Hi Dale,

At first I was confused because I expected a mouse click to toggle the selection state
I found now however that deselecting is as with regular deselecting via CTRL+LMB.

For my purpose I need the possible objects to select to be limited, but I’ll see what I can come up on my own with after scrutinizing what the Custom.GetObject() has to offer.

Thanks for getting me up to speed!
-Willem